Step 1: Assessing the Damage
Our team will inspect your home to find out the extent of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the water leak and find out the best course of action to fix it. Accurate diagnosis is key to a successful restoration.
Step 2: Containment and Cleanup
We’ll set up a containment system to prevent further damage and debris from spreading. Our team will then begin the cleanup process, removing any water-damaged materials and debris. Quick action is crucial to prevent m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ry your home and remove excess moisture. Our team will monitor the drying process to ensure it’s completed correctly and efficiently. Proper drying is critical to preventing future water damage.
Step 4: Reconstruction and Repair
Once the drying process is complete, our team will begin the reconstruction and repair phase. We’ll work with you to identify the best materials and solutions for your home’s specific needs. Our goal is to restore your home to its original condition.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that all work is complete and your home is restored to its original condition. We’ll also provide you with a thorough cleaning and disinfecting of your home. Our attention to detail ensures your home is safe and healthy.

Corroded Pipe Water Removal Cost In Ashland, MA
The cost of corroded pipe water removal in Ashland, MA varies based on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Get a free estimate today. Our team will assess the situation and provide a customized solution to fit your needs and bud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and inspection | $100 – $500 | Severity of the issue and size of the affected area |
| Containment and cleanup |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area and complexity of the job |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and equipment needed |
| Reconstruction and rep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of the affected area and materials needed |
| Final inspection and c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and complexity of the job |
| Free estimate and consultation | $0 – $100 | Location and complexity of the issue |
